  1 a8l miniature rocker switch rocker switch for high current switching withstands inrush currents up to 100 a due to a unique switching mechanism. soft touch with firm switching action. easy to mount by snap fitting. contact gap of 3 mm minimum. ul and cul standards approved. conforms to en standards. ordering information specifications ratings note: 1. the non-inductive lamp load has an impulse current ten times the normal current. 2. the inductive load has a power factor of 0.4 minimum (ac). 3. the motor load has an impulse curr ent 6 times the normal current. the above ratings were tested under the following conditions: 1. ambient temperature:20 2 c 2. ambient humidity:65% 5% 3. switching frequency:7 times/min color of caps and cases (flanges) marking on caps solder terminals pcb terminals right- angled pcb terminals left- angled pcb terminals quick- connect terminals #187 solder terminals pcb terminals right- angled pcb terminals left- angled pcb terminals quick- connect terminals #187 black without markings a8l-11- 11n1 a8l-11- 12n1 a8l-11- 13n1 a8l-11- 14n1 a8l-11- 15n1 a8l-21- 11n1 a8l-21- 12n1 a8l-21- 13n1 a8l-21- 14n1 a8l-21- 15n1 a8l-11- 11n2 a8l-11- 12n2 a8l-11- 13n2 a8l-11- 14n2 a8l-11- 15n2 a8l-21- 11n2 a8l-21- 12n2 a8l-21- 13n2 a8l-21- 14n2 a8l-21- 15n2 rated load non-inductive inductive resistive load lamp load inductive load inductive motor load 125 vac 10 a 10 a 8 a 8 a 250 vac 10 a 10 a 8 a 8 a spst 2 1 dpst 2 1 4 3
2 a8l a8l characteristics note: consult your omron representa tive for details of performance characteri stics with respect to individual standards. approved safety standards dimensions note: all units are in millimeters unless otherwise indicated. solder terminals operating characteristics pcb terminals operating characteristics permissible operating frequency mechanical: 20 operations/min max. electrical: 7 operations/min max. insulation resistance 100 m ? min. (500 vdc) dielectric strength 2,000 vac, 50/60 hz, for 1 min between terminals of the same polarity 2,000 vac, 50/60 hz, for 1 min between terminals of the different polarity 4,000 vac, 50/60 hz, for 1 min between charged metal parts and the ground terminal vibration resistance malfunction:10 to 55 hz, 1.5-mm double amplitude (malfunction time of 1 ms max.) shock resistance malfunction: 300 m/s 2 (malfunction time of 1 ms max.) destruction: 500 m/s 2 life expectancy mechanical: 50,000 operations min. electrical: 10,000 operations min. inrush current 100 a max.
